Step v. Walking

I've been doing a lot of brisk walking this year, including steep hills. This has been virtually my only form of cardio besides the occasional Hiit workout.

This morning I did Cathe's Athletic Step but modified everything to low impact as I am still protective of my right knee. I had forgotten how much a low impact step workout, even done with no risers as I did this morning, gets my HR up. Too bad this style or cardio is no longer very popular.

Who here still does step and what are your favorite ones?

I am a wuss. I use *no* risers. The long step bench I have is the defunct Super Step which is 5 inches without any risers:


When that feels too high (if a workouts moves too fast for instance), then I go down to my shorter Home Step without risers, which is 4 inches.

Before I got hurt, I was using two sets of risers on each side. I had to go down to no risers for a number of years. I've only recently gone up to one set of risers. I probably won't go any higher, for fear of aggravating my hip. I do use two sets of risers on Cathe's LIS series, as it's quite low impact, but anything with impact it's one set or no risers.
